Output 3bb517d17e14bb810415afcfa9447d8e624bb76b34c1a639a129136d45af425b:0

value
3420576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32b77dd5c51f3127a469a24ab7413b3992c8ab88 OP_EQUALVERIFY OP_CHECKSIG
address
15dAboqFNViMYkW9dxrJrADbhj8wqemXrR
transaction
3bb517d17e14bb810415afcfa9447d8e624bb76b34c1a639a129136d45af425b
confirmations
480750
spent
true